14. THYC Start Line
The standard THYC start line will be used. The start line is a transit between the fixed white light below the race station and a post on the end of south outer pier of the entrance to Hartlepool Marina. The start line is also designated by inner & outer distance buoys which may be tide bourne and not on the transit.Please note that yachts must not enter the Hartlepool channel at any time after the 5 minutes signal.
15. Starting Procedure
Lights will be shown from THYC tower in accordance with T&HYC standard starting procedures:-5 min - 1 white light
4 min - 2 white lights
1 min - 3 white lights
Start - all lights out
16. SYC Finishing Line
A line between the SYC race office and the northern most point of the masonry on the South pier of the entrance to Sunderland harbour
Please note that the red can channel nautical buoy (if in position) off the South pier of Sunderland harbour is a mark of the course and must be left to port.
Leading boat entering Sunderland harbour is requested to call the Racing Station.
Yachts finishing may be given lights. All boats are advised to take their own finishing times (GPS) in the event that the finish line is not manned.
